The Excitement Surrounding Macchio's Return
Ralph Macchio's return as Daniel LaRusso is a significant event for long-time fans of the Karate Kid franchise. His iconic portrayal cemented Daniel's place in cinematic history, and the character's enduring appeal speaks volumes about Macchio's performance and the franchise's lasting impact. The success of Cobra Kai, the popular Netflix series continuing the story, has only amplified this excitement.
- Macchio's iconic portrayal of Daniel LaRusso cemented his place in cinematic history. His performance resonated with audiences, making Daniel a relatable and inspiring character.
- The success of Cobra Kai has reignited interest in the Karate Kid franchise and its characters. The show successfully breathed new life into the old story, introducing new characters while staying true to the original spirit.
- Many fans are eager to see Daniel LaRusso's story continue, particularly given the cliffhangers in Cobra Kai. The series finale left many plot threads open, fueling speculation and anticipation for a potential resolution on the big screen.
- Nostalgia plays a significant role in the positive response, with fans hoping for a continuation of the beloved franchise's spirit. The Karate Kid films hold a special place in the hearts of many, and the prospect of a new movie evokes strong feelings of nostalgia and excitement.
Concerns and Reservations about Karate Kid 6
Despite the excitement, a significant portion of the fanbase expresses reservations about a Karate Kid 6. These concerns stem from a variety of factors, primarily focusing on the potential impact on the franchise's legacy and the inherent risks associated with sequels.
- Some fans worry that a new Karate Kid movie might negatively impact the legacy of the original films and Cobra Kai. The fear is that a poorly executed sequel could tarnish the positive memories associated with the franchise.
- Concerns exist about potential sequel fatigue and the risk of diluting the franchise's core themes. Too many sequels can lead to a sense of repetition and a loss of the original magic.
- Questions arise about the storyline and whether a new film can deliver a satisfying narrative without relying on nostalgia. Simply rehashing old plots or characters won't be enough; a fresh and compelling story is crucial.
- Some fans believe the story of Daniel LaRusso has already reached a natural conclusion. The events of Cobra Kai provided a sense of closure for many fans, leaving them questioning the necessity of another installment.
The Impact of Cobra Kai on Fan Expectations
The phenomenal success of Cobra Kai has significantly impacted expectations for a potential Karate Kid 6. The show raised the bar for storytelling within the Karate Kid universe, creating a complex and nuanced narrative that surpassed the expectations of many.
- ** Cobra Kai has set a high bar for storytelling and character development within the Karate Kid universe.** The show's writing, acting, and overall production quality have set a new standard for the franchise.
- Fans expect a similar level of quality and depth in any future Karate Kid installments. Anything less would be considered a disappointment by many die-hard fans.
- Concerns exist about maintaining continuity between Cobra Kai and a potential Karate Kid 6. A disconnect between the two could alienate fans of the show.
- The success of Cobra Kai has also raised expectations for the potential Karate Kid 6. The bar has been set high, and the new film needs to meet, or even exceed, those expectations to be successful.
